1. Ovaltine. Ovaltine is a chocolate malted milk powder and is one of the best non-diastatic substitutes for malt powder. The original Ovaltine recipe contained malt powder in its ingredients. Ovaltine has a strong malt smell and flavor, making it highly suitable as a replacement in recipes.

3. Soy Milk Powder. Soy milk powder is mostly readily available all over, and with a small adjustment to the sweetness, it makes for a great substitute for malt powder. As soy milk powder is not as sweet as malt powder, you will need to add a sweetener along with it if the recipe needs added sweetness.

Malt milk powder is a powder made from wheat flour, evaporated whole milk powder, and malted barley. Malted milk powder is an excellent substitute for malt powder and can be used to add color, flavor, and sweetness to baked goods. Use malted milk powder as a 1:1 replacement for malt powder in recipes. 2. Ovaltine Powder.

8)Milk Powders. Milk powders, like coconut and soy, are other replacements for diastatic malt powder. Similar to evaporated milk, coconut milk powder is derived from coconut meat while the soy milk powder is derived from soy milk with all the water having been removed.

Powdered Milk: Similarly to soy milk powder, you can use most other types of powdered milks as a malt powder substitute. Cow's milk and coconut milk powder both make great malt powder replacements and are widely found in grocery stores. Powdered milk work as a one-to-one substitute for malt powder.

Malted Milk Powder: This is a mixture of malted barley, wheat flour, and powdered milk. It can be used as a 1:1 substitute for malt powder in most recipes. Barley Malt Syrup: This thick, sticky syrup is made from malted barley and can be used as a liquid substitute for malt powder. Use 1/2 cup of barley malt syrup for every 1/4 cup of malt.
